ספקטרוגרם: חישוב, רזולוציה ופרשנות

des. 01 2025
מקור: DiGi-Electronics
גלול: 780

ספקטרוגרמה מראה כיצד תדרי האות משתנים לאורך זמן באמצעות צבעים, מה שמקל על ראיית דפוסים, פיצוצים, רעש ומודולציה. מאמר זה מסביר כיצד ספקטרוגרמות שונות מתצוגות אחרות, כיצד הן מחושבות, כיצד רזולוציה והגדרות ויזואליות משפיעות על הדיוק, וכיצד לקרוא דפוסים. הוא מספק מידע ברור ומפורט על כל חלק בנושא.

Figure 1. Spectrogram

סקירת ספקטרוגרם

ספקטרוגרמה היא תמונה שמראה כיצד תדרי האות משתנים לאורך זמן. זה נראה כמו מפה צבעונית עם זמן בציר האופקי, תדר בציר האנכי, וצבע שמראה כמה חזק האות. תצוגה זו מקלה על הבנת מה קורה בתוך האות ברגעים שונים. הוא עוזר לחשוף שינויים איטיים בתדר, שינויים פתאומיים, התפרצויות קצרות ודפוסים שנוצרים על ידי סוגי מודולציה שונים. הוא גם מראה שינויים ברעש הרקע והופך אותות חלשים ליותר מורגשים, אפילו כאשר יש צלילים חזקים יותר.

ספקטרוגרמות לעומת ספקטרום ותצוגות מפל מים

Figure 2. Spectrograms vs. Spectrum and Waterfall Displays

הבדלים עיקריים

בעוד ששלושתם מציגים תכולת תדרים, רק ספקטרוגרמות ומפלים מציגים התנהגות משתנה בזמן. ספקטרום מראה רגע יחיד, בעוד מפל המים מצטבר על ספקטרום אך מדגיש מגמות ארוכות טווח. ספקטרוגרמה מציעה תצוגת זמן-תדר מפורטת וממופה בצבעים.

טבלת השוואה

מאפייןספקטרום (עלילה של FFT)ספקטרוגרםתצוגת מפל
מידע משתנה בזמןלאכןכן
מידע על תדריםכןכןכן
משרעת מוצגתכןכן (מקודד בצבעים)כן (גובה או צבע)
הטוב ביותר עבורצילום מצב מיידישינויים לאורך זמןמגמות היסטוריות ארוכות

יסודות חישוב ספקטרוגרמה

תהליך שלב אחר שלב

• פיצל את האות למסגרות קצרות וחופפות.

• יישם פונקציית חלון (למשל, האן או המינג) על כל פריים.

• מחשב את ה-FFT של כל מסגרת חלון כדי לקבל את הספקטרום שלו.

• המרת גדלי הספקטרום לערכי dB או לערכי עוצמה ליניארית.

• מיפוי עוצמות לצבעים כדי להראות רכיבים חלשים וחזקים.

• למקם את הספקטרום לפי סדר הזמן כדי ליצור את הספקטרוגרמה המלאה.

גורמים המשפיעים על דיוק

פרמטרתפקיד בספקטרוגרמה
אורך חלון (גודל FFT)שולט בפרטי תדרים. חלונות ארוכים יותר מראים רזולוציית תדר עדינה יותר.
סוג חלוןמעצב את האופן שבו כל פרוסה מעובדת ומפחית ארטיפקטים לא רצויים.
אחוז חפיפהחפיפה גבוהה יותר נותנת רזולוציית זמן חלקה יותר.
קצב דגימהקובע את התדר הגבוה ביותר שניתן להציג.

רזולוקציית זמן–תדר בספקטרוגרמות

Figure 3. Time–Frequency Resolution in Spectrograms

חלון ארוך יותר (רזולוציית תדר טובה יותר)

• מפריד בין תדרים הקרובים זה לזה

• מראה שינויים איטיים בתדר בצורה ברורה יותר

• מפחית את הבהירות של אירועים מהירים או קצרים

חלון זמן קצר יותר (רזולוציית זמן טובה יותר)

• מראה שינויים פתאומיים בצורה ברורה יותר

• לוכד שינויים מהירים בתדר

• מייצר תחומי תדרים רחבים או פחות מפורטים

טיפים לספקטרוגרמה לא רציפה לניטור אותות לטווח ארוך

חוזקות

מתאים לניטור אותות לטווח ארוך. צורכת פחות זיכרון בהשוואה להקלטה רציפה. עובד טוב לשינויים איטיים או מדי פעם. מועיל לבדיקות עמידה לאורך זמן

חולשות

לא יעיל לפרצים מהירים או בלתי צפויים. אינו מספק תצוגת זמן רציפה מלאה. הדיוק תלוי כמה טוב כל פרוסה מופעלת.

עבור אותות עם התנהגות מהירה, גישה רציפה מספקת תובנות ברורות יותר.

ספקטרוגרמות רציפות לניתוח אירועים מהירים

Figure 4. Continuous Spectrograms for Fast Event Analysis

ספקטרוגרם רציף משתמש בהקלטה ארוכה עם חלון מחליק וחופף כדי לספק תצפית ללא רווחים. שיטה זו לוכדת אירועים מהירים, מתיישרת עם צורת הגל, ותומכת בקורלציה מפורטת של חבילות, פולסים וסמלים.

יתרונותתיאור
אין פערים בציר הזמןכל רגע של האות כלול.
לוכד שינויים מהיריםמראה בבירור התפרצויות, שינויים מהירים, תקלות ואירועים מהירים נוספים.
מיושר עם צורת הגלתואם את אות תחום הזמן ללא הפסקות.
תומך בקורלציה מפורטתעוזר לנתח חבילות, סמלים ומבנים ברמה עדינה אחרים.

מפות צבע ספקטרוגרמה והגדרות קנה מידה

מפות צבע

Figure 5. Color Maps

מפת צבעתיאור
אינפרנו / וירידיסחלק ועקבי, עוזר להראות שינויים בצורה ברורה.
ג'טבהיר וצבעוני, אבל הוא יכול לשנות את האופן שבו הנתונים נתפסים.
חום (שחור - אדום - צהוב)מדגיש את החלקים החזקים של האות בצורה ברורה יותר.

קנה מידה של משרעת

Figure 6. Amplitude Scaling

סוג קנה מידההטוב ביותר עבורתיאור
ליניאריאותות בטווח דינמי נמוךמציג שינויים ישירות אך עשוי להסתיר פרטים חלשים מאוד.
dBאותות בטווח דינמי רחבדוחס את הטווח כך שחלקים חזקים וחלשים יהיו קלים יותר להשוואה.

ניהול טווח דינמי

Figure 7. Dynamic Range Management

הגדרת טווחאפקט
צר מדיהצבעים הופכים לרוויים, מה שהופך את התצוגה לקשה לקריאה.
רחב מדיחלקים חלשים של האות נעלמים בעלילה.

איך לקרוא ספקטרוגרם?

דפוסי ספקטרוגרמה נפוצים

• קו אופקי - טון רציף או נשא

• רצף אנכי - דחף קצר או פרץ מהיר

• עקבה אלכסונית - סריקת תדר או ציוץ

• רעש מקובץ - הפרעות בפס רחב

• פסי צד סימטריים - מודולציית AM או PM

• התפרצויות תקופתיות - פעילות חבילות או אותות פולסים

טיפים פשוטים לפרשנות ספקטרוגרמות

• שים לב לצורות חזרתיות כדי לזהות מודולציה או פעילות רגילה

• בדוק את עוצמת הצבע כדי לראות את ההבדל בין אותות חזקים לחלשים יותר

• לעקוב אחרי תנועת התדר כדי לזהות סטייה או קפיצה

• הסתכל על רוחב האות כדי להבין FM, התפשטות או ג'יטר

מדריך הגדרות חלונות ספקטרוגרם

מטרה ניתוחיתסוג חלוןגודל FFTחפיפההערות
זיהוי התפרצויות קצרותהאןקצר75–95%טוב לאירועים מהירים
זיהוי תדרים קרוביםבלאקמןלונג50–75%פרטים בתדרים גבוהים
קבל אמפליטודה מדויקתפלט-טופבינוני25–50%עוזר לשיפור דיוק הרמות
הקטנת האונות הצדדיותבלקמן-האריסבינוני50–75%עוזר לחשוף אותות ברמה נמוכה
ניטור בזמן אמתהמינגבינוני50–80%בהירות ומהירות מאוזנת

יישומים בספקטרוגרמה 

RF & אלחוטי

ספקטרוגרמות מסייעות בזיהוי הפרעות, בדיקת פעילות קפיצות תדר, ניטור פליטות לא רצויות וזיהוי אי-יציבות בשלבי הספק RF.

אודיו ודיבור

הם מקלים על זיהוי פונמות, סיבילנס ופורמנטים, תוך זיהוי חיתוך, עיוות וארטיפקטים נוספים באותות שמע.

רדאר והגנה

בעבודת רדאר, ספקטרוגרמות חושפות ציוצים, רכבות פולס, פעילות שיבוש ופרטים הקשורים לטכניקות דחיסת פולס.

מכנית & רטט

הם מסייעים בזיהוי תדרי מיסבים, לעקוב אחרי תהודה בתיבת ההילוכים, ולזהות אירועי פגיעה קצרים במכונות מסתובבות או נעות.

אותות ביו-רפואיים

ספקטרוגרמות שימושיות למעקב אחר שינויים בזמן-תדירות EEG ו-ECG ולזיהוי התפרצויות חריגות או אי-סדירות בקצב.

סיכום 

ספקטרוגרמות חושפות התנהגות זמן ותדר כאחד, ועוזרות להבין צלילים, פרצי מים, רעש ומודולציה. על ידי בחירת הגדרות החלון הנכונות, חפיפה, מפת צבעים וקנה מידה, התצוגה הופכת לברורה ואמינה יותר. עם הגדרה נכונה וקריאה מדוקדקת, ספקטרוגרמות מספקות תצוגה מלאה של פעילות האותות מבלי לפספס שינויים מהירים או מגמות ארוכות טווח.

שאלות נפוצות [שאלות נפוצות]

באילו פורמטים ניתן לשמור ספקטרוגרמה?

ניתן לשמור אותו כ-PNG, JPG או TIFF לתמונות, וכ-CSV, MAT או HDF5 לנתונים גולמיים.

האם ספקטרוגרם מציג מידע פאזה?

לא. ספקטרוגרמה סטנדרטית מראה רק עוצמה. הפאזה דורשת ספקטרוגרם פאזה נפרד.

כיצד רצפת הרעש משפיעה על ספקטרוגרמה?

רצפת רעש גבוהה יכולה להסתיר אותות חלשים, מה שמקשה לראות אותם.

מדוע נדרש עיבוד מוקדם לפני יצירת ספקטרוגרמה?

עיבוד מוקדם, כמו סינון או הסרת DC, מסייע בהסרת תוכן לא רצוי ומשפר את הבהירות.

האם ספקטרוגרמות יכולות להתעדכן בזמן אמת?

כן. עם עיבוד FFT מהיר וחלונות קצרים, הם יכולים לפעול ברציפות ככל שהנתונים מגיעים.

האם ספקטרוגרמות עובדות עם אותות I/Q מורכבים?

כן. נתוני ה-I/Q מומרת לגודל או הספק לפני יצירת הספקטרוגרמה.